    State info:

    Mississippi

    Mississippi, Magnolia State, MS; a state in the Deep South on the gulf of Mexico - one of the Confederate States during the American Civil War

    Mississippi is a state located in the Deep South of the United States. Jackson is the state capital and largest city. The state's name comes from the Mississippi River, which flows along its western boundary, and takes its name from the Ojibwe word misi-ziibi ("Great River"). The state is heavily forested outside of the Mississippi Delta area. Its catfish aquaculture farms produce the majority of farm-raised catfish consumed in the United States. The state symbol is the magnolia.
